How long do you have to work at Wal-Mart before you can transfer?
By Forinfos - 07/10/2025 - 0 comments
Wal-Mart employees must work at Wal-Mart for a minimum of six months before they can transfer to another store or department. However, there are exceptions, such as emergency situations and special circumstances. Speaking with a supervisor and typing out a written request can be helpful.
To give a written request for transfer, include a request to transfer to a specific store, reasons why you are a valuable employee and the reason you are seeking a transfer. Be honest about your reason but also be professional. Do not include overly personal reasons for transferring, such as relationship issues. This can look very unprofessional.
